Output 18b115f85670c1e69b3c603c633d22c8c302bc2a00ee866491f3833f8a24025a:1

value
97317819
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f948e4dc3f6aa50b75df18e12ce3bb40bb94cddb OP_EQUAL
address
3QR7W59xvWgmmnbpQvvgzK3vv8LfdyixpQ
transaction
18b115f85670c1e69b3c603c633d22c8c302bc2a00ee866491f3833f8a24025a
spent
true